AGRICULTURE: Gillian Shephard, the Minister of Agriculture, criticised an EC proposal on the definition of butter as 'unnecessarily elaborate' at Monday's Agriculture Council in Luxembourg, she said in a written reply. She also questioned a proposed directive on minced meat and other meat preparations. 'My main aim is to avoid excessively strict criteria that would put at risk traditional British products,' she said.

SCHOOLS: Between 1991 and 1992 the number of primary school children being taught in classes of more than 40 increased by 24 per cent, Eric Forth, Under-Secretary at Education, said.
